Theoretical Studies of Rydberg Atom Collisions.

Abstract

During the last two years, theoretical studies were performed on a variety of topics related to collisions involving Rydberg atoms. Progress was made towards the understanding of ion-Rydberg atom, Rydberg atom-Rydberg atom, and ground state atom-Rydberg atom collisions. Cross sections were calculated for electron capture, ionization, and excitation processes and parametrized in terms of atomic parameters. A strong dc electric field was also incoporated in calculations of electron capture and ionization cross sections for ion-Rydberg atom collisions. The results of this latter investigation indicate the design of a far ir photon detector which is based on the field ionization of Rydberg atoms may be limited by the collision processes. (Author)
